thinkphp3.0 模板中函数的使用


Posted in PHP onNovember 13, 2012

变量的来源:

1 从php分配的变量,使用assign分配
2 系统变量
3 路径替换变量
不能使用函数的变量
变量输出快捷标签
{@var}//输出Session变量 和{$Think.session.var}等效
{#var}//输出Cookie变量 和{$Think.cookie.var}等效
{&var}//输出配置参数 和{$Think.config.var}等效
{%var}//输出语言变量 和{$Think.lang.var}等效
{.var}//输出Get变量 和{$Think.get.var}等效
{^var}//输出POST变量 和{$Think.post.var}等效
{*var}//输出常量 和{$Think.const.var}等效
{@var1.var2}//输出$_SESSION['var1']['var2']
{#var1.var2}//输出$_COOKIE['var1']['var2']

一 转换成大写 {$title|strtoupper}

模板变量的函数调用格式为:

{$varname|function1|function2=arg1,arg2,### }

说明:
{ 和 $ 符号之间不能有空格 ,后面参数的空格就没有问题 ###表示模板变量本身的参数位置 支持多个函数,函数之间支持空格 支持函数屏蔽功能,在配置文件中可以配置禁止使用的函数列表 支持变量缓存功能,重复变量字串不多次解析
使用例子: X

{$webTitle|md5|strtoupper|substr=0,3}
PHP 相关文章推荐
用php写的serv-u的web申请账号的程序
Oct 09 PHP
php中的时间显示
Jan 18 PHP
探讨PHP中this,self,parent的区别详解
Jun 08 PHP
php去掉文件前几行的方法
Jul 29 PHP
PHP的Yii框架中创建视图和渲染视图的方法详解
Mar 29 PHP
ThinkPHP简单使用memcache缓存的方法
Nov 15 PHP
微信公众平台开发-微信服务器IP接口实例(含源码)
Mar 05 PHP
PHP与JavaScript针对Cookie的读写、交互操作方法详解
Aug 07 PHP
php+js实现裁剪任意形状图片
Oct 31 PHP
在laravel-admin中列表中禁止某行编辑、删除的方法
Oct 03 PHP
Thinkphp 在api开发中异常返回依然是html的解决方式
Oct 16 PHP
TP5多入口设置实例讲解
Dec 15 PHP
thinkPHP的Html模板标签使用方法
Nov 13 #PHP
PHP数组及条件,循环语句学习
Nov 11 #PHP
php对mongodb的扩展(初出茅庐)
Nov 11 #PHP
PHP面向对象——访问修饰符介绍
Nov 08 #PHP
PHP ? EasyUI DataGrid 资料存的方式介绍
Nov 07 #PHP
PHP ? EasyUI DataGrid 资料取的方式介绍
Nov 07 #PHP
PHP正确解析UTF-8字符串技巧应用
Nov 07 #PHP
You might like
检查php文件中是否含有bom的函数
2012/05/31 PHP
php设计模式之单例、多例设计模式的应用分析
2013/06/30 PHP
PHP数组排序之sort、asort与ksort用法实例
2014/09/08 PHP
解析PHP的Yii框架中cookie和session功能的相关操作
2016/03/17 PHP
PHP MVC框架skymvc支持多文件上传
2016/05/26 PHP
javascript 鼠标滚轮事件
2009/04/09 Javascript
COM中获取JavaScript数组大小的代码
2009/11/22 Javascript
js中if语句的几种优化代码写法
2011/03/12 Javascript
js Event对象的5种坐标
2011/09/12 Javascript
document.getElementById介绍
2011/09/13 Javascript
JQUERY 获取IFrame中对象及获取其父窗口中对象示例
2013/08/19 Javascript
JavaScript 垃圾回收机制分析
2013/10/10 Javascript
基于jQuery实现的美观星级评论打分组件代码
2015/10/30 Javascript
AngularJs bootstrap搭载前台框架——js控制部分
2016/09/01 Javascript
AngularJS表单基本操作
2017/01/09 Javascript
详解js的异步编程技术的方法
2017/02/09 Javascript
基于Axios 常用的请求方法别名(详解)
2018/03/13 Javascript
js实现同一个页面,多个enter事件绑定的示例
2018/10/10 Javascript
Vue动态创建注册component的实例代码
2019/06/14 Javascript
Vue如何实现变量表达式选择器
2021/02/18 Vue.js
[06:45]DOTA2卡尔工作室 英雄介绍幻影长矛手篇
2013/07/12 DOTA
Python手机号码归属地查询代码
2016/05/04 Python
Python实现八大排序算法
2016/08/13 Python
机器学习10大经典算法详解
2017/12/07 Python
Python图像处理之识别图像中的文字(实例讲解)
2018/05/10 Python
python粘包问题及socket套接字编程详解
2019/06/29 Python
python实现按键精灵找色点击功能教程,使用pywin32和Pillow库
2020/06/04 Python
python如何提升爬虫效率
2020/09/27 Python
Notino意大利:购买香水和化妆品
2018/11/14 全球购物
UNIX操作系统结构由哪几部分组成
2016/02/17 面试题
怎样写好自荐信和推荐信
2013/12/26 职场文书
《忆江南》教学反思
2014/04/07 职场文书
烹饪大赛策划方案
2014/05/26 职场文书
元旦联欢会策划方案
2014/06/11 职场文书
校长师德师风自我剖析材料
2014/09/29 职场文书
“鬼灭之刃”热度不减,其成功背后的原因是什么?
2022/03/22 日漫